30 and you say, ‘If we had lived in the days of our ancestors, we would not have joined them in shedding the prophets’ blood.’ 31 Thus you bear witness against yourselves that you are the children of those who murdered the prophets; 32 now fill up what your ancestors measured out!

Is there a social justice application for this verse? Please exlain:confused:

Social justice is reaching a bit, I would think. It was a condemnation of those who were about to demand His death - the descendants of those who shed the blood of the prophets who prophesied Jesus to their ancestor’s generation.
